Builds muscle strength

Bouldering is an incredible workout that can help you build impressive muscle strength. As you climb, your muscles have to work hard to support your body weight and navigate the challenging routes.

This means that every time you grab onto a hold or push yourself up, you’re giving your muscles a serious workout. In particular, bouldering targets important muscle groups like your back, shoulders, arms, and core.

Not only does bouldering engage these major muscle groups, but it also targets smaller stabilizing muscles that are often neglected in traditional workouts. This results in a well-rounded strength training routine that builds functional strength and helps improve overall athleticism.

So whether you’re reaching for the next hold or powering through a tough move, know that each climb is contributing to building strong and toned muscles throughout your entire body.

Improves flexibility and balance

One of the great benefits of bouldering for fitness is how it improves flexibility and balance. As climbers navigate challenging routes, they need to stretch, reach, and contort their bodies in various ways.

This dynamic movement helps to increase flexibility by stretching the muscles and joints through a wide range of motion. Additionally, bouldering requires precise footwork and body positioning to maintain stability on the rocks, which enhances balance skills.

So not only will you be building strength and endurance with bouldering, but you’ll also be improving your overall flexibility and balance capabilities. Keep pushing yourself on those routes – your body will thank you!

Combats depression and stress

Bouldering isn’t just a physical workout; it’s also an effective way to combat depression and stress. As you navigate challenging routes and conquer difficult climbs, your brain releases feel-good chemicals like endorphins, serotonin, and dopamine that elevate your mood and reduce anxiety.

The focus required when bouldering helps redirect your attention away from negative thoughts or worries, providing a mental escape from the stresses of everyday life.

In addition to the chemical benefits, bouldering can also help build resilience and boost self-confidence. Each successful climb is a small victory that proves what you’re capable of achieving.

Over time, this sense of accomplishment transfers into other areas of life, helping you overcome challenges off the rocks as well.
